Recipe by Lindsay Funston Everything you love in beef tacos, only without the tortillas.

Ingredients

1 lb. ground beef 1 tbsp. Taco Seasoning 1 tsp. kosher salt 1 15-ounce can diced tomatoes 1 15-ounce can black beans, rinsed 1 4.5-ounce can diced green chilis 1 c. shredded Mexican cheese Scallions, for garnish

Instructions

In a large skillet over medium-high heat, cook ground beef until golden and no longer pink, 6 to 8 minutes. Season with taco seasoning and salt stir until combined. Add canned tomatoes, black beans, and green chilis and stir until combined. Blanket with cheese and let melt, then garnish with scallions and serve.
